About the Company

Adani Group is a diversified Indian conglomerate consisting of 10 publicly traded companies. It has established a leading presence nationwide across logistics and utility infrastructure sectors, managing world-class portfolios headquartered in Ahmedabad, Gujarat. The Group focuses on large-scale infrastructure development, benchmarked with global operations and maintenance standards. It stands unique as India's sole infrastructure entity with an investment grade rating.

Adani Green Energy Limited (AGEL), a subsidiary, embodies the Group’s commitment to a cleaner future by developing, building, owning, operating, and maintaining utility-scale solar, wind, and energy storage projects across 12 states in India. AGEL aims for 50 GW renewable capacity by 2030, leveraging long-term Power Purchase Agreements with government entities and adopting cutting-edge technologies for round-the-clock green power supply integration.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age storage infrastructure, manpower, and tools for safe and efficient material handling onsite following SOP compliance.
  • Ensure process adherence for material receipt posting, stock audits, timely closure of Returnable Gate Passes, and preparation of Goods Receipt Notes within defined SLAs.
  • Oversee inventory control including monitoring slow-moving and surplus stock, implementing optimization techniques (VED/FAS/Min-Max/ABC), and coordinating disposal of scrap and surplus materials with proper approvals.
  • Lead project store management functions with zero deviation from SOPs, establishing adequate infrastructure, manpower planning, team leadership, training, and policy compliance.
  • Coordinate with Head Office and regional teams through MIS reporting, presentations, and inventory reviews.
  • Drive continuous improvements integrating digital inventory management tools, enforce ESG norms in storage and waste disposal, and ensure compliance with hazardous material handling and regulatory audits.
  • Ensure driver compliance with safety inductions, valid licenses, and proper unloading protocols.
